People Score in 45146, Martinsville, Ohio

The People Score for the Overall Health Score in 45146, Martinsville, Ohio is 69 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 94.84 percent of the residents in 45146 has some form of health insurance. 36.36 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 74.04 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 45146 would have to travel an average of 11.91 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Highland District Hospital. In a 20-mile radius, there are 682 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 45146, Martinsville, Ohio.
